DXYN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

32 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dixie Group Inc (DXYN)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$22.8M — down 48% from $43.8M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 8 funds closed out of DXYN and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 9 trimmed existing stakes and 6 added.

The largest buyer was First Eagle Investment Management, adding an estimated $310K. The largest seller was EAM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.52M sold.
